Went to the Warragul sale
a small sale but a nice drive

Noted some nice Kakariki’s
One seller had the following:
Green split pied
Green pied
Cinnamon Pied
Fallow $100 each
BEC $100 each
Lutino $150 each
Some birds were a little small; however it was nice to see a dedicated breeder.

I also noted several very nice Violet Fischer lovebirds (it’s a transmutation from Mask), these were very pure looking and according to the seller 7th gen which is 127/128 breed – 99.21875% Fischer/0.78125% Mask, someone had obviously put the effort into them.
